Abstract

The invention relates to a pen, in particular to a quick-matching anti-falling pen, which comprises an inner pen holder, a front pen holder, a rear pen holder, a reset spring and a pen core; in order to solve the problems of falling prevention and quick matching of the existing pen tool, the quick matching falling prevention pen is provided, and has the advantages of falling, automatic retraction and protection of the pen core, so that the technical effect of falling prevention is achieved, the operation mode is optimized, single-hand operation can be realized, and the retraction and exposure of the pen core can be completed by keeping the normal pen holding posture; the writing gesture correcting function is also added, so that the holding gesture can be prevented from being excessively close to the pen point, if the finger is applied to the pen point, the pen point is excessively close to the pen point, and the pen point can be recovered into the pen shell, so that the pen cannot be used, the pen is required to be re-exposed, and the pen is prevented from touching the inner pen holder; the exposed length of the inner pen holder determines the maximum distance that the finger can grip near the pen point.

Description of the embodiments
The invention is further described below with reference to the accompanying drawings.
Examples
The quick-fit anti-drop pen shown in figures 1-5 comprises an inner pen holder 1, a front pen holder 2, a rear pen holder 3, a reset spring 5 and a pen core 4. The inner pen holder 1 is sleeved in the front pen holder 2 in a sliding way. The front pen holder 2 is in threaded fit connection with the rear pen holder 3. The front end of the rear pen container 3 is provided with a matched hole 32, and the rear end is provided with a fixed clamping seat 31. The pen core 4 is arranged in a pen shell formed by combining the inner pen holder 1, the front pen holder 2 and the rear pen holder 3, and the tail end of the pen core 4 is fixed in the fixing clamping seat 31. The reset spring 5 is positioned in the inner penholder 1, and is particularly positioned between the inner penholder 1 and the pen core 4. The front end of the front pen holder 2 is provided with a supporting inner ring 21. The inner pen holder 1 is provided with a supporting ring protrusion 13 and a buckle extending inner table 16. The above-mentioned snap-extending inner stand 16 and the mating hole 32 are engaged with each other, and when the snap-extending inner stand 16 enters the mating hole 32, a snap force is generated, so that the snap-extending inner stand is not easy to leave the mating hole 32. The outer diameter of the support ring boss 13 is larger than the inner diameter of the support inner ring 21. The inner pen holder 1 is blocked by the supporting inner ring 21, and the exposed length of the inner pen holder is not more than 45mm at maximum than that of the front pen holder.
In order to realize the switching between the two states of withdrawing the pen shell and exposing the pen shell, when the inner platform 16 of the buckle extension is clamped with the matched use hole 32, the pen shell is exposed, namely, in the use state, and when the inner platform 16 of the buckle extension is not clamped with the matched use hole 32, the pen shell is withdrawn, namely, in the non-use state.
As a further preferred aspect of the present invention: the fixed holder 31 is composed of a mounting landslide 311, a fixed inner table 312 and a limiting inner table 313. The 2 or more fixed inner stages 312 are annularly distributed in the rear barrel 3, the formed break-point type annular protrusions are formed, and the pen core 4 is relatively fixed after entering the break-point type annular protrusions through the mounting landslide 311, so that the clamping force is generated. The limiting inner platform 313 is also distributed in a ring shape, and forms a breakpoint type limiting platform, the inner diameter of the breakpoint type limiting platform is smaller than the outer diameter of the pen core 4, and the pen core 4 cannot enter the breakpoint type limiting platform.
As a further preferred aspect of the present invention: the elastic force of the restoring spring 5 is larger than the gravity of the inner pen holder 1, specifically, when the inner pen holder 1 is pressed against the restoring spring 5, the difference between the compressed deformation distance and the uncompressed state distance is smaller than the distance between the pen point of the pen core and the pen tip of the inner pen holder in the unused state. Based on the above conditions, the smaller the elastic force of the return spring 5 is, the better. The smaller the difference between the compressed deformation distance and the uncompressed state distance, the better.
As a further preferred aspect of the present invention: the force of the engagement between the pen core 4 and the fixing holder 31 is greater than the force of the engagement between the extended inner base 16 and the mating hole 32. The engagement and disengagement between the snap-extended inner stage 16 and the engagement hole 32 does not affect the state in which the cartridge 4 is fixed in the rear barrel 3.
As a further preferred aspect of the present invention: the surface of the inner platform 16 may also be provided with an outer collar 1633. The male collar 1633 may be engaged with the mating aperture 32 instead of the snap-extending inner platform 16. The matching hole 32 is also provided with a matching landslide 321, a fixed inner convex point 322 and/or a fixed concave ring 323. The fixed inner protruding point 322 and/or the fixed inner concave ring 323 can be engaged with the outer convex ring 1633 instead of the matched hole 32, and if the outer convex ring 1633 does not exist in the inner extended buckle table 16, the fixed inner protruding point 322 and/or the fixed inner concave ring 323 can be engaged with the inner extended buckle table 16 instead of the matched hole 32. If the wear-resistant soft sleeve 162 is provided, the fixing inner protruding point 322 and/or the fixing inner concave ring 323 can be engaged with the wear-resistant soft sleeve 162 instead of the hole 32. The slope of the matching landslide 321 can help the buckle to extend the inner table 16 and the outer convex ring 1633 into the matched hole 32 quickly, so that the matching landslide can be clamped with the matched hole 32, the fixed inner convex point 322 and/or the fixed inner concave ring 323. Further increases the clamping effect, thereby reducing the generated friction area, improving the clamping tension and being more beneficial to clamping. Through the cooperation between outer convex ring 163 and fixed inner convex point 322 and/or fixed concave ring 323, can realize more stable block mode, then block through the form of buckle, but use the sense of setback strong. The wear-resistant soft sleeve 162 and the matched hole 32 are adopted, or the clamping of the clamping extension inner platform 16 and the matched hole 32 is realized by adopting a friction clamping mode, so that no pause feeling is realized, but the matched friction force must overcome the elasticity continuously generated by the reset spring 5, so that the clamping state failure is avoided. If the wear-resistant soft sleeve 162 is sleeved on the outer convex ring 1633, the shock feeling can be reduced, and meanwhile, the wear-resistant soft sleeve is clamped in a buckle mode, so that the wear-resistant soft sleeve is stable and has small shock feeling.
The installation method comprises the following steps:
1. the nib end of the inner pen holder is firstly arranged in the front pen holder and is sleeved in the front pen holder from the end, far away from the inner ring, of the front pen holder.
2. The pen refill is fixed in the fixed clamping seat of the rear pen container.
3. The reset spring is arranged in the inner penholder.
4. The pen point of the pen core is inserted into the front pen holder and the inner pen holder and penetrates through the reset spring.
5. The front pen holder and the rear pen holder are assembled in a threaded manner.
The using method comprises the following steps: the palm and tiger mouth clamps the front pen holder and/or the rear pen holder. The index finger and the middle finger clamp the inner pen holder to slide. The inner pen holder is in a non-use state when the exposed distance of the inner pen holder relative to the front pen holder is increased, the exposed distance of the inner pen holder relative to the front pen holder is minimized, and the inner stand 16 is buckled with the matched use hole 32 in a buckled manner, so that the inner pen holder is in a use state.
